Prime Lilliput location, quarter-acre corner plot
Set on a generous quarter-acre corner plot in prime Lilliput, this substantial detached home offers 3,146 sq ft of well-proportioned, versatile living. The heart of the house is an open-plan kitchen/breakfast/dining space with shaker cabinetry, granite worktops and a Smeg range cooker, flowing into a bright insulated-roof conservatory and terrace — excellent for family entertaining and everyday living.
Four double bedrooms each have their own character and built-in wardrobes; two bedrooms benefit from en suites and a well-appointed family bathroom serves the remainder. Ground-floor flexibility comes from a study/snug that could accommodate a guest or ground-floor bedroom, plus a cloakroom and separate utility room. High-quality finishes include solid oak flooring, coving, double glazing and gas central heating throughout.
Outside, electric gates lead to an expansive block-paved driveway and a detached double garage with pitched roof, providing secure parking and substantial storage for at least three vehicles or a boat. The mature, landscaped plot includes terraces, a paved patio and established planting, offering privacy and attractive outlooks in a very low-crime, affluent area close to beaches, marinas and top schools.
Practical points to note: the property was built in 2002 and shows generally excellent presentation, but some buyers may wish to check EPC and glazing install dates if energy performance is a priority. Council tax banding is relatively expensive. Overall this is a roomy, well-located family home that suits buyers seeking space, strong local schools and easy access to coastal amenities.
